More power from my vortec v6?

i have a 94 C1500 with a 4.3 vortec v6 it has 90,000miles on it. i would like to give it some more power but im not sure where to start. it has a straight pipe and glasspack after the cat but it sounds like shit so i will put a flowmaster on payday. any ideas?also where can i get chrome for this motor?

Re: More power from my vortec v6?

The 4.3 wasn't a popular option in full-size trucks, but it is a decent, reliable engine that can put out good power. There are camshafts, roller rockers, higher flow fuel injectors, air intakes available. Edelbrock makes intake manifolds for the 4.3L and various performance chips are available. I had decent success with Jet's Stage 1 chip in my '96 Jimmy. You won't make gobs of power, but I'd say 220-240 hp is fairly obtainable...it all boils down to how fast you wanna go and how much you have to spend. Good luck!
